The Huasteca is the largest and most complex cultural region of Mexico spread between six states in the centre and north east of the country. The many indigenous tribes and mestizo people famously have an enormous pride in their shared cultural heritage, rich gastronomy, traditions, folk art and even music and dances. Huasteca has it all!
